+01 (977) 2599 12


Close this search box.


Masdar City Free Zone, Abu Dhabi

Get a Quotation

Business Setup in Masdar City Freezone, Abu Dhabi

Welcome to the visionary development of Masdar City, brought to you by Prodigy Corporate Services – your trusted partner for business setup in Abu Dhabi, UAE. Join us as we explore this remarkable sustainable city that is redefining the future of urban living and providing unparalleled opportunities for businesses.

Masdar City, located in the vibrant capital of the United Arab Emirates, is a testament to the innovative spirit and commitment to sustainability. As a forward-thinking business, partnering with Masdar City can elevate your brand and showcase your dedication to a greener, more sustainable future.

Prodigy Corporate Services understands the immense potential that Masdar City offers for businesses seeking to thrive in an eco-conscious environment. By setting up your business in Masdar City, you gain access to a dynamic ecosystem that embraces cutting-edge technologies, fosters innovation, and promotes collaboration among like-minded entrepreneurs and professionals.

At the core of Masdar City’s sustainable infrastructure is its focus on renewable energy. With state-of-the-art solar power systems, wind farms, and advanced waste management solutions, Masdar City has emerged as a global leader in clean energy initiatives. By aligning your business with this sustainable energy hub, you not only contribute to reducing carbon emissions but also enhance your brand’s reputation as an environmentally responsible organization.

Beyond its commitment to renewable energy, Masdar City offers a thriving business community that prioritizes research and development in sustainable technologies. By being part of this innovative ecosystem, your business can tap into a pool of top talent, collaborate with leading researchers, and stay at the forefront of industry advancements. Prodigy Corporate Services is here to guide you through the setup process, ensuring a seamless transition and providing valuable insights into the unique business landscape of Masdar City.

Masdar City is more than just a sustainable business hub. It is a vibrant community that fosters a high quality of life for residents and employees alike. With world-class residential areas, cultural attractions, educational institutions, and recreational spaces, Masdar City offers a well-rounded and balanced environment. By establishing your business in this thriving city, you attract talented professionals who value work-life balance and contribute to the overall well-being of your workforce.

At Prodigy Corporate Services, we specialize in assisting businesses in their journey to establish a presence in Abu Dhabi, UAE. With our comprehensive knowledge of local regulations, licensing procedures, and corporate services, we are well-equipped to guide you through the setup process in Masdar City. Our experienced team is dedicated to providing personalized solutions tailored to your business needs, ensuring a smooth and efficient setup that aligns with your goals.

Join Prodigy Corporate Services on this exciting venture toward sustainable growth by choosing Masdar City as the destination for your business. Contact us today, and let us help you unlock the boundless opportunities that await in this groundbreaking sustainable city.

What is the Process of registering a company in Masdar City Free Zone

The process of setting up a business in Masdar City Free Zone follows a well-defined procedure. Here is an overview of the steps involved:

  1. Initial Enquiry: The process begins with an initial enquiry to Masdar City Free Zone. You can reach out to their business setup team to discuss your business requirements, understand the available options, and gather information regarding the free zone’s offerings, facilities, and benefits.
  2. Business Plan Submission: After the initial enquiry, you will be required to prepare a comprehensive business plan detailing your company’s activities, goals, and projected financials. This business plan will serve as a roadmap for your business setup in Masdar City Free Zone.
  3. Application Submission: Once your business plan is ready, you can proceed to submit your application to Masdar City Free Zone. The application form, along with the required documents, should be completed and submitted as per the guidelines provided by the free zone authorities.
  4. Evaluation and Approval: The submitted application will undergo a thorough evaluation by the free zone authorities. They will assess the feasibility of your business, its alignment with the free zone’s vision and objectives, and compliance with the applicable regulations. Upon successful evaluation, you will receive an approval letter from Masdar City Free Zone.
  5. Legal Documentation: After receiving the approval, the next step is to complete the legal documentation process. This includes signing the relevant agreements, lease contracts, and any other necessary legal documents. It is important to carefully review and understand the terms and conditions before signing the agreements.
  6. Licensing and Registration: Once the legal documentation is completed, you can proceed with obtaining the necessary licenses and registrations. Masdar City Free Zone offers various types of licenses based on your business activities, such as commercial, service, or industrial licenses. You will need to submit the required documents, pay the applicable fees, and fulfill any additional requirements specific to your business activities.
  7. Office Space and Visa Processing: Masdar City Free Zone provides a range of office spaces and facilities to choose from. You can select the option that best suits your business needs. Additionally, if you require visas for yourself or your employees, you can initiate the visa processing through the free zone’s dedicated immigration services department.
  8. Company Formation and Commencement: Once all the above steps are completed, you will receive the final documents, including your trade license and establishment card. With these in hand, you can officially commence your business operations in Masdar City Free Zone.

It is important to note that the specific requirements, procedures, and timelines may vary depending on the nature of your business and the applicable regulations at the time of your application. It is recommended to consult with the business setup team at Masdar City Free Zone or engage the services of a professional business setup provider for accurate and up-to-date guidance throughout the process.

Documents Required To Register A Company In Masdar City free Zone

  1. To set up a business in Masdar City Free Zone, you will need to prepare and submit certain documents. The specific requirements may vary based on the type of business and the activities you plan to undertake. Here is a general list of documents typically required for company formation in Masdar City Free Zone:

    1. Application Form: You will need to complete the official application form provided by Masdar City Free Zone. This form will require details about your company, shareholders, activities, and other relevant information.
    2. Business Plan: Prepare a comprehensive business plan that outlines your company’s objectives, projected financials, marketing strategies, and operational details. The business plan should demonstrate the feasibility and sustainability of your business venture.
    3. Passport Copies: Submit clear copies of the passports of all shareholders, directors, and legal representatives involved in the company. The passport copies should be valid and have a minimum remaining validity as per the requirements.
    4. Proof of Address: Provide proof of address for all shareholders, directors, and legal representatives. This can be in the form of utility bills, bank statements, or residential lease agreements. The documents should clearly display the name and address of the individuals.
    5. Memorandum of Association (MOA) and Articles of Association (AOA): If your company is a corporate entity, you will need to provide the MOA and AOA, which outline the company’s structure, shareholding, and governing rules.
    6. Bank Reference Letter: Obtain a bank reference letter from the shareholders or directors of the company, confirming their good standing with the bank and their financial stability.
    7. Curriculum Vitae (CV): Prepare detailed CVs for all shareholders, directors, and legal representatives. The CVs should include information about their educational background, professional experience, and relevant skills.
    8. Corporate Documents (if applicable): If your company is a corporate entity, you will need to provide additional documents such as a Certificate of Incorporation, Certificate of Good Standing, and Certificate of Incumbency for the parent company.
    9. No Objection Certificate (NOC): In some cases, you may be required to provide a No Objection Certificate from your current sponsor or employer if you are currently residing and working in the UAE.

    It is important to note that the requirements may vary based on the specific business activities, the company’s structure, and the regulations in place at the time of application. It is recommended to consult with the business setup team at Masdar City Free Zone or engage the services of a professional business setup provider for accurate and up-to-date information regarding the required documents for your specific case.

Benefits of registering a company in Masdar City free zone

Masdar City Free Zone offers several benefits to businesses looking to establish their presence in Abu Dhabi. Here are some key advantages of setting up in Masdar City Free Zone:

  1. Strategic Location: Masdar City Free Zone is strategically located in Abu Dhabi, the capital of the United Arab Emirates. Its proximity to major business centers, transportation hubs, and international airports provides easy access to global markets, making it an ideal choice for businesses seeking regional and international connectivity.
  2. Sustainable Infrastructure: Masdar City Free Zone is renowned for its commitment to sustainability and clean technology. It offers a green and eco-friendly environment, powered by renewable energy sources such as solar and wind. By operating in a sustainable ecosystem, businesses can enhance their corporate image and contribute to the global efforts for environmental conservation.
  3. State-of-the-Art Facilities: The free zone provides world-class infrastructure and cutting-edge facilities designed to meet the needs of various industries. From modern office s